Sagittarius Mars

In a natal chart, having Mars in Sagittarius infuses the individual with an adventurous spirit and a relentless desire for exploration. This placement bestows a natural curiosity that drives them to seek out new experiences, be it through travel or intellectual pursuits. The fiery essence of Sagittarius means that these individuals often approach challenges with enthusiasm and optimism, viewing obstacles as opportunities for growth rather than setbacks. Their boldness can inspire those around them, encouraging a sense of camaraderie in shared adventures.

However, this position also brings forth unique challenges; there’s often a tendency towards restlessness or impatience. Those with Mars in Sagittarius may find it difficult to commit fully to projects or relationships if they feel confined or stagnant—thriving instead in dynamic environments that fuel their zest for life. With an innate gift for storytelling and sharing experiences, they can captivate audiences effortlessly, turning mundane moments into grand narratives filled with excitement and wonder. Balancing their need for freedom with responsibility is key; when they harness their energy purposefully, they become unstoppable catalysts for positive change wherever they roam.

Sagittarius Mars in the First House

Those with Natal Sagittarius Mars in the first house are said to have an adventurous spirit and a desire for freedom and independence. This placement is also known for giving individuals with an energetic and confident demeanor. The first house in astrology represents the self, identity, and outward appearance. This means that people with Natal Sagittarius Mars in this house may come across as bold and daring to others. They tend to have a strong presence and are not afraid to take risks or stand up for what they believe in. However, this placement can also lead to impatience and impulsiveness at times. People with Natal Sagittarius Mars in the first house may struggle with being too quick-tempered or making hasty decisions without fully thinking them through.

Sagittarius Mars in the Third House

Natal Sagittarius Mars in the third house is a combination that brings about a lot of energy, enthusiasm and excitement to communication, learning and daily routine. In astrology, Mars represents our drive and ambition while the third house governs communication, siblings, short journeys and intellect. Hence, with this placement, individuals are prone to be very vocal about their opinions and beliefs which can sometimes come across as confrontational. The fiery nature of Mars when combined with the adventurous spirit of Sagittarius makes for an individual who loves exploring new ideas and viewpoints. They are not afraid to challenge traditional norms or take risks in their pursuits. However, they must learn to balance their need for freedom with responsibility especially when it comes to communication as they may have a tendency towards oversharing or coming on too strong.

Sagittarius Mars in the Fifth House

Natal Sagittarius Mars in the fifth house can be an exciting placement for those who possess it. The fifth house rules creativity, self-expression, and children. With Mars in this house, individuals may feel compelled to express themselves more boldly and creatively. They may also feel a strong desire to engage with children or become involved in activities related to children. This placement can bring about a sense of adventure and spontaneity when it comes to creative pursuits. Individuals with Natal Sagittarius Mars in the fifth house may feel drawn towards activities such as drama, dance, or music that allow them to express their inner emotions openly. They may also enjoy engaging in sports or other physical activities that allow them to express themselves physically. This placement is all about embracing one's passions and following one's heart without fear of judgment from others.

Sagittarius Mars in the Ninth House

Natal Sagittarius Mars in the ninth house is a placement that represents a strong desire to explore and expand one's horizons. The ninth house governs higher education, philosophy, religion, travel, and foreign cultures. With Mars in this house, individuals with this placement are often driven to seek out new experiences and learn about different ways of living. This placement also suggests an individual who has a deep passion for knowledge and may be drawn towards subjects like theology or spirituality. They may feel strongly about their beliefs and have a need to share them with others. This can lead them to become involved in activism or advocacy work related to their chosen cause. However, Natal Sagittarius Mars in the ninth house can also lead to restlessness and impulsivity if not channeled properly. These individuals may struggle with commitment as they are always seeking something new and exciting.



Sagittarius Mars in the Tenth House

Mars is known as the planet of action and energy, while the tenth house represents career and public image. When these two elements combine and are influenced by the adventurous spirit of Sagittarius, it creates a unique blend of ambition, drive, and enthusiasm. Individuals with this placement tend to have a strong desire for success in their chosen career path. They are not afraid to take risks or speak their truth, which can lead to them being seen as bold or even controversial at times. However, their confidence and determination often pay off in terms of professional achievements. On the downside, those with Natal Sagittarius Mars in the tenth house may struggle with authority figures or feeling restricted by traditional work environments. They thrive on freedom and independence, which can sometimes clash with more structured corporate cultures.

Sagittarius Mars in the Twelfth House

Natal Sagittarius Mars in the Twelfth house is an astrological aspect that indicates a powerful drive for spiritual growth and inner transformation. The twelfth house is often associated with hidden aspects of our psyche, such as subconscious fears, secrets, and past traumas that may have a significant impact on our lives. When Mars is placed in this house, it intensifies our desire to delve into these areas and confront them head-on. Individuals with Natal Sagittarius Mars in the Twelfth house are highly intuitive and empathetic. They possess an innate ability to sense other people's emotions and understand their needs without even being told. This gift can make them excellent healers or counselors who can help others overcome their emotional wounds. However, it's essential for them to be aware of their boundaries since they tend to absorb other people's energy easily.
